Saving a sb4 file while having sections hidden may lead to irreversible hiding of the sections. For those who want to get their hidden section back, you can manually edit sb4 file with notepad, find the lines with 2nd number after 1st comma to be negative, add 7000 to the negative number to update t...

Performance: I noticed that the use of mining laser to create a flare effect with 'burst' and 360 'initial deviation' has major performance impact depending the number set in 'burst'. For me frame rate dropped by half from using 8 instead of 4. Not sure if this is a correctable bug or implementation...
